Cooper Tire Launches Patriotic Promotion
Dealer Campaign Enters Second Year
FINDLAY, Ohio, May 26, 2004 – COOPER TIRE & RUBBER COMPANY (NYSE: CTB), an American-owned company, announces a special marketing opportunity for its tire dealers. Consumers who purchase a set of four Cooper tires starting Memorial Day through Flag Day and ending the Fourth of July receive an American flag and flagpole free of charge.
This is the second year for the flag promotion. In June 2003, more than 200 tire dealers nationwide gave nearly 20,000 flags to Cooper customers during the month-long giveaway. Cooper Tire is providing all of its dealers with the promotional materials for the campaign and reimbursing 100 percent of the cost for the flags in addition to any local media coverage dealers may purchase.
"Beth Barron, director of business development for Chabill’s Tire Traxx, a Louisiana-based tire dealer with 10 stores, proposed the concept for the promotion in an effort to maximize the local marketing co-op dollars Cooper provides its dealers," states Pat Brown, vice president, global branding and communications for Cooper Tire. "We liked the idea so much that we extended the marketing opportunity to our dealer network nationwide."
"Cooper does such an outstanding job helping us sell tires locally," Barron says of Chabill’s Tire Traxx 25-year relationship with the tire company. "The point-of-sale and marketing materials they have provided dealers for this campaign are especially helpful."
Cooper Tire has sent dealers across the country a marketing kit that includes 30-second radio scripts and detailed print advertising specific to the flag promotion.
"It’s reassuring to know that a large supplier such as Cooper Tire is interested in the local efforts of its tire dealers. This promotion is just one example of Cooper’s relationship with the local distributor," Barron said.
About Cooper Tire
Cooper Tire & Rubber Company, headquartered in Findlay, Ohio, specializes in the manufacture and marketing of products for the global automotive industry. Products include automotive, motorcycle and truck tires, inner tubes, tread rubber and equipment, as well as sealing, trim, NVH control systems and fluid handling systems. Cooper has more than 20,000 employees and 52 manufacturing facilities in 13 countries. For more information, visit the Company’s web site at: www.coopertireandrubber.com.
